Boston's iconic 2.5 mile-Freedom Trail connects 16 nationally significant historic sites, each one an authentic treasure. From Boston Common to Charlestown, this can be self-guided or hop on a tour. Grab a drink and lunch at Monument in Charlestown or a Guinness at Warren Tavern once completed!

Enjoy the nice weather in Boston's Seaport District. Beautiful waterfront access, Shopping, Breweries (Harpoon, Cisco), and grab a Lobster Roll at The Barking Crab for the true Boston experience.
Spend time walking along the Boston Shoreline through South Boston, Seaport, Downtown, North End, Charlestown, Cambridge and more! A great way to see the sites and sounds of Boston.
